"It is a player who has an interesting future ahead of him. He wants our club to help him further develope his skills, which is an appreciation of our work, "said general manager of AS Trencin Róbert Rybníček. "Negotiations of his transfer took long, and certainly were not easy. However, we are glad that finally we found a common ground with Domžale. In no small measure contributed to transfer Antonio, as he really showed great interest in AS Trencin. "
Croatian youth representant played for Domžale 41 matches and scored 13 goals. In summer in the qualifying phase of the Europa League he played against West Ham United. "Antonio has a natural instinct of a striker. He has a quality right and left foot play. We believe that our training process will give him even more power and dynamics. I´d hate to be wrong, but our fans have something to look forward. On the other hand, we know that he will need some time for acclimatization. Nevertheless, we hope that he will help the squad already in the spring part of the competition, "added in the end Rybníček.
